The problem with TS% is that when you take into account free throws you penalize a guy like Waiters for something that he can, and probably will correct. He shot 68% from the Free Throw line, which is unacceptable, but he shot 37% for 3 and 43% from the field, and those are decent numbers for a second year player who was basically the second option in our terrible Mike Brown offense. For comparison, Irving shot 36% from 3 and 43% from the field, similar to Waiters, both career lows. Yes, our offense was frustrating last season

If he fixes his Free Throw mechanics and his finishing at the rim, he'll be a very dangerous player. He's already a skilled and willing passer, so if he can add those 2 things to his game and become a true scoring threat, other teams will find it very tough to contain him.
